What is the chemical reaction in a lithium ion battery?

Lithium ion batteries work by using the transfer of lithium ions and electrons from the anode to the cathode. At the anode, neutral lithium is oxidized and converted to Li+. . This results in the reduction of Co(IV) to Co(III) when the electrons from the anode reaction are received at the cathode.

What happens when you charge a lithium ion battery?

When the battery is charging, positively-charged lithium ions move from one electrode, called the cathode, to the other, known as the anode, through an electrolyte solution in the battery cell. That causes electrons to concentrate on the anode, at the negative side. When the battery is discharged, the reverse happens.

What is the chemical reaction in batteries?

The battery operates through electrochemical reactions called oxidation and reduction. These reactions involve the exchange of electrons between chemical species. If a chemical species loses one or more electrons, this is called oxidation. The opposite process, the gain of electrons, is called reduction.

What happens when a battery is charging?

When A Battery Is Being Charged Charging is a process that reverses the electrochemical reaction. It converts the electrical energy of the charger into chemical energy. Remember, a battery does not store electricity; it stores the chemical energy necessary to produce electricity.

What is lithium-ion charge?

Li-ion is fully charged when the current drops to a set level. In lieu of trickle charge, some chargers apply a topping charge when the voltage drops. The advised charge rate of an Energy Cell is between 0.5C and 1C; the complete charge time is about 2–3 hours.

What is lithium charge?

A lithium battery can be charged as fast as 1C, whereas a lead acid battery should be kept below 0.3C. This means a 10AH lithium battery can typically be charged at 10A while a 10AH lead acid battery can be charged at 3A. The charge cut-off current is 5\% of the capacity, so the cutoff for both batteries would be 0.5A.

Can lithium batteries overcharge?

Overcharging of lithium batteries leads to irreversible damage to cell components and may cause serious safety problems. 1 Over- charging of one or more cells within a high voltage multicell stack of the type required for vehicle traction can render the entire stack inoperative.

What is the difference between lithium and lithium-ion batteries?

Lithium-ion batteries use an intercalated lithium compound as the material at the positive electrode and usually graphite at the negative electrode. Lithium-ion batteries have a much higher energy density, and no memory effect (other than LFP cells), and low self-discharge.
